## 3.0.0

- [issues #20, #39, #25, #26, #41] LdapAuth is now inheriting EventEmitter and re-emits ldapjs error events. This should solve crashing because of network issues or such. Other ldapjs events are not emitted.

## 2.3.0

- [passport-ldapauth issue #10] Added support for fetching user groups. If `groupSearchBase` and `groupSearchFilter` are defined, a group search is conducted after the user has succesfully authenticated. The found groups are stored to `user._groups`:

```javascript
new LdapAuth({
  "url": "ldaps://ldap.example.com:636",
  "adminDn": "cn=LdapAdmin,dc=local",
  "adminPassword": "LdapAdminPassword",
  "searchBase": "dc=users,dc=local",
  "searchFilter": "(&(objectClass=person)(sAMAccountName={{username}}))",
  "searchAttributes": [
    "dn", "cn", "givenName", "name", "memberOf", "sAMAccountName"
  ],
  "groupSearchBase": "dc=groups,dc=local",
  "groupSearchFilter": "(member={{dn}})",
  "groupSearchAttributes": ["dn", "cn", "sAMAccountName"]
});
```
